It's seemed to be trending this way for a bit, but now it's officially official. Former FSU standout James Ramsey is Georgia Tech's new head baseball coach, replacing Danny Hall who retired after 32 years with the Yellow Jackets.

Ramsey just wrapped up his seventh season as the GT hitting coach. Now, he's the head coach of a team he grew up in proximity to as an Alpharetta, Ga. native.

That's now three former FSU players holding head coaching positions in the ACC between Link Jarrett at FSU, Mike Bell at Pitt and Ramsey in Atlanta.
